Question 833671: how do I put this quadratic equation into general form? The fraction is making it complicated. Thank you.
1/5(3x^2-10)=12x

1/5(3x^2-10) = 12x
multiply both sides by 5
3x^2 - 10 = 60x
3x^2 - 60x - 10 = 0
